Example of Java List
Java
// Java program to Demonstrate List Interface // Importing all utility classes import java.util.*; // Main class // ListDemo class class GFG { // Main driver method public static void main(String[] args) { // Creating an object of List interface // implemented by the ArrayList class List<Integer> l1 = new ArrayList<Integer>(); // Adding elements to object of List interface // Custom inputs l1.add( 0 , 1 ); l1.add( 1 , 2 ); // Print the elements inside the object System.out.println(l1); // Now creating another object of the List // interface implemented ArrayList class // Declaring object of integer type List<Integer> l2 = new ArrayList<Integer>(); // Again adding elements to object of List interface // Custom inputs l2.add( 1 ); l2.add( 2 ); l2.add( 3 ); // Will add list l2 from 1 index l1.addAll( 1 , l2); System.out.println(l1); // Removes element from index 1 l1.remove( 1 ); // Printing the updated List 1 System.out.println(l1); // Prints element at index 3 in list 1 // using get() method System.out.println(l1.get( 3 )); // Replace 0th element with 5 // in List 1 l1.set( 0 , 5 ); // Again printing the updated List 1 System.out.println(l1); } } |
[1, 2] [1, 1, 2, 3, 2] [1, 2, 3, 2] 2 [5, 2, 3, 2]

List Interface in Java with Examples
The List interface in Java provides a way to store the ordered collection. It is a child interface of Collection. It is an ordered collection of objects in which duplicate values can be stored. Since List preserves the insertion order, it allows positional access and insertion of elements.
